French Drain Replacement in Birmingham, AL
French drain replacement services involve removing and updating existing drainage systems designed to redirect excess water away from a property’s foundation, basement, or landscaping. These projects typically address issues such as persistent basement flooding, pooling water around the yard, or soil erosion caused by poor drainage. Property owners often seek this service when an older or damaged drain no longer functions effectively, or when changes to the landscape require an updated drainage solution to prevent water-related problems.
Before requesting a French drain replacement, property owners should consider the current condition of their drainage system, the extent of water issues, and the overall layout of their property. It’s helpful to understand where water tends to collect, the type of soil, and any existing underground utilities that might affect installation. Clear information about the area’s drainage challenges and desired outcomes can ensure the replacement process addresses specific needs and provides long-term relief from water management concerns.

French Drain Replacement Questions
What signs indicate a French drain needs replacement? Signs include persistent dampness, musty odors, or standing water around the foundation that don't improve with drainage adjustments.
Why should a French drain be replaced instead of repaired? Replacement is recommended when the drain is clogged, damaged, or no longer effectively redirects water away from the property.
What types of projects typically require French drain replacement? Common projects include basement waterproofing, yard drainage improvements, and foundation protection after drainage system failure.
How can property owners prepare for a French drain replacement? Clearing the area of obstacles and informing the contractor of existing drainage issues helps ensure a smooth replacement process.
